– On RAW, we saw Vickie Gurrero involved in series of skits with The Authority that ultimately saw Stephanie McMahon vomiting all over Vickie. This is setting up Vickie being written off television. We reported exclusively around WrestleMania 30 that Vickie was finishing up with WWE to pursue a career in medical administration. While she extended her time with WWE by a few months, she is in fact leaving the company.

In related Vickie Gurrero news, there were a lot of people rolling their eyes last night at the nature of her skit with Stephanie. Aside from the skit being ‘classic’ Vince McMahon gross-out comedy, many felt the vomit angle was in bad taste, since’s Vickie’s daughter (former NXT Diva Shaul Marie Guerrero) took time off from WWE due to her suffering from an eating disorder.

    Exclusive: WWE Cuts NXT’s Budget, NXT Releases Coming Soon

    72

    Last week, WWE released 11 people (Brodus Clay, Drew McIntyre, Jinder Mahal, Evan Bourne and others) in an effort to reduce company spending. Now, we can confirm that NXT is the next target of these cost cutting measures.

    A well-placed source at NXT has confirmed to us that NXT’s budget has already been cut in terms of production and post-production. The talent roster is about to be evaluated, with a number of cuts set to take place in the next month.

    WWE is “staggering” the widespread budget cuts so the company appears to be fiscally responsible to Wall Street and doesn’t set off a widespread panic internally.

  • 10 Reasons the WWF vs. WCW Invasion Angle Failed (Part 2)

    35

    As promised, here is the second half of the list…

    5. Abundance Of Talent Led To Brand Extension

    3e5f1cf6-a03e-4f74-ad1e-7d3b1f23b5060

    The WWE roster was absolutely stacked following the acquisition of WCW. This was especially true after the top WCW superstars such as Hulk Hogan, Goldberg, and Kevin Nash eventually signed with the company.

    It quickly became apparent that there was too much talent to adequately feature everyone on a weekly basis. This led to the WWE splitting into two separate brands in the form of Raw and SmackDown. The brand extension seemed fresh at first, but it quickly lost traction after superstars were constantly shifted from one brand to the other as a way to increase ratings.

    The brand extension era is characterized by pay-per-views that did not perform as well as those in the Attitude Era, largely because fans did not want to pay to see only half of the roster.

    CM Punk & AJ Lee Married

    109

    Former WWE Superstar CM Punk and WWE Diva AJ Lee are now married.

    The two began dating in the Fall of 2013 and were engaged back in April. AJ was seen wearing what appeared to be an engagement ring on the March 31st episode of WWE RAW (Photo).

    The new Mr. and Mrs. Brooks attended at a Chicago Cubs game on May 17th, where Punk confirmed they were engaged and would be getting married in June.

    AJ Lee recently moved to Chicago and is taking time off from WWE for her wedding and honeymoon. She’s expected to return to action this summer.

  • 10 Reasons the WWF vs. WCW Invasion Angle Failed (Part 1/2)

    31

    20010401_vkm

    During the summer of 2001, the WWE was under attack and at risk of a hostile takeover. After finally winning the Monday Night Wars, the WWE had to find a way to integrate the influx of talent that was acquired with the purchase of WCW.

    Their first attempt at doing so would come in the form of the Invasion storyline, which saw former WCW and ECW employees “invading” the WWE in an attempt to take over the company. If this sounds a bit like the nWo’s plot to conquer WCW, well that’s because it is essentially the same story.

    Ultimately, the program forced the WWE to fend off the intruders by forming a coalition to battle Team Alliance, which was led by Shane and Stephanie McMahon, the respective on-screen owners of WCW and ECW at the time.

    Many fans have cited the Invasion storyline as one of the most entertaining periods in recent WWE history, as it featured a number of matchups that had previously been unimaginable. However, there were many aspects of the storyline that could have been handled better, resulting in a program with great potential that was squandered by poor booking. Here are ten reasons why the Invasion storyline was not as memorable as some fans recall.

    Pat Patterson “Coming Out” Makes Mainstream Headlines

    53

    While it wasn’t a shock to anyone in the pro wrestling world, Pat Patterson’s revelation that he is gay on the season finale of “Legends House” got a lot of mainstream media attention.

    The news made headlines on celebrity-gossip website TMZ, where the website claimed that Patterson “explained that he’s been keeping the secret out of the public eye for 5 decades … and had a partner for roughly 40 years, but he passed away after suffering a heart attack.”
